如果我理解正确的话,两者都会在应用程序之外的某个地方存储有关inapp purchses的信息。
https://developer.android.com/google/play/billing/billing_overview.html https://developer.apple.com/library/content/documentation/NetworkingInternet/Conceptual/StoreKitGuide/Chapters/Restoring.html#//apple_ref/doc/uid/TP40008267-CH8-SW9
我只是想确保我真正理解它: 用户可以重新安装应用程序并获取他已经支付的功能。并且应用程序不需要拥有自己的服务器和远程数据库,以便在用户重新安装时能够恢复此数据。
答案 0 :(得分:1)
这是正确的,您无需担心付款,还原应用。如果用户在另一部手机上安装应用程序或重新安装应用程序(他/她的应用程序内购买标志根据其登录ID返回true)。在app中处理应用内购买流程是我们(开发人员)的责任(例如显示额外的流量,提升游戏等级,app中的虚拟商品。需要由开发人员照顾)。